B.C. executive to lead 'wise-persons' committee
Article Abstract:
A new seven-member committee that will study possible reforms of Canada's securities rules will be headed by Michael Phelps, an energy executive. The "wise-persons" committee will examine ways to reform Canada's "patchwork" securities regulations.

BCE revisits Telesat IPO after talks fail
Article Abstract:
BCE Inc. has allowed its Telesat Canada unit to go for an initial public offering of $1 billion, after several acquisition deals fell through.
